论文部分内容阅读
随着电子技术和计算机技术的高速发展催生了新的测试方法、理论和仪器的出现。这些新的仪器技术在许多方面冲破了传统仪器的概念,测量仪器的功能开始发生了质的变化,在这种背景下,虚拟仪器应运而生。虚拟仪器借助于计算机的软硬件平台建立的测试与控制系统,其“软件即仪器”的思想代表了未来仪器技术的发展方向。通过虚拟仪器技术,用户可以根据自己的需求设计自己所需的仪器系统,满足多种多样的应用需求。本文以美国National Instruments(简称NI)公司的LabVIEW图形化编程语言和其软件本身带有的模糊逻辑工具箱,PID工具包,仿真模块(SimulationModule)等为开发平台。设计了一个电机转台伺服系统控制效果测试分析的上位机软件,采用串口进行数据的传输采集,代替了昂贵的数据采集卡。首先,阐述了本课题研究的背景及其意义,描述了虚拟仪器国内外研究现状和电机转台伺服控制效果测试的研究现状,针对以上研究现状的分析,并提出了本文的研究课题,基于虚拟仪器的上位机系统的电机转台伺服系统的测试研究分析。对研究的电机转台整个被控对象也进行了详细的介绍。其次,详细阐述了上位机软件的编程,上位机系统通过RS422串口通信实现了数据的通信,其包括:向下位机运动控制指令的传输,控制参数PID的在线调节,对电机转台数据的实时采集等。同时上位机亦实现了数据的处理、统计分析、时域以及频域的分析等功能。上位机、下位机和被控对象共同组成了一个完整的伺服控制系统。最后,分析了伺服系统的模型。对本文所研究的电机转台中的永磁直流力矩电动机进行了理论的建模,并利用频域特性测试法,实现了对电机转台伺服系统的传递函数的辨识。该系统的特点是无需增加额外的硬件设备,只需要利用所编写的上位机系统即可实现全数字化的伺服系统辨识系统。通过理论误差的分析,该系统简单可靠,应用性较广泛。并在辨识的基础上,增加了算法仿真模块,更加完善了上位机系统。